Research On Low Temperature Cracking Mechanism And Prevention Measures Of Asphalt Pavement In Alpine Region

As the main disease of asphalt pavement in alpine region,low temperature cracking not only destroys the continuity and aesthetics of pavement,but also causes water seepage along cracks.Under the action of freeze-thaw cycle,it produces diseases such as looseness,mesh cracking and subsidence.More serious,it will soften the base,cause the decline of bearing capacity of pavement and reduce the service life of pavement.The low temperature cracking of asphalt pavement in alpine region is influenced by many factors,such as pavement structure,material,external environment,cooling and so on.Especially,the phenomenon of pavement cracking and destruction caused by the arrival of cold wave in alpine region is very common in a short time,which makes the causes of the cracking more complex.However,most of the existing studies focus on the effect of non-Alpine region or temperature cycle on pavement fatigue cracking.There is no consideration of the cooling effect of cold wave or cold current in the special climatic conditions of alpine regions.Therefore,it is necessary to study the mechanism and prevention measures of low temperature cracking of asphalt pavement in alpine region,which can provide theoretical basis and reference for the structural design,material selection and prevention of low temperature cracking of asphalt pavement in alpine region,and has important practical engineering application value.(1)Analysis of environmental characteristics and typical pavement diseases in alpine region.Based on literature review and meteorological data of China Meteorological Data Network,the geo-climatic characteristics,pavement structure and materials,typical types of pavement diseases and their causes in alpine regions represented by Tibet were investigated and analyzed,which laid a foundation for the establishment of temperature field and temperature stress model.(2)Establishment of low temperature cracking analysis model for asphalt pavement in alpine region.In ABAQUS modeling process,calculation model,analysis condition,pavement structure and material parameters,initial temperature field of pavement and determination of boundary conditions are discussed.Thereby,temperature field and temperature stress analysis model of asphalt pavement in alpine region is established.(3)Analysis of low temperature cracking mechanism of asphalt pavement in alpine region.Based on the analysis of influencing factors of low temperature cracking of asphalt pavement in alpine region,the influence of pavement structure,material and environmental factors on temperature field and thermal stress of asphalt pavement during cooling process is analyzed to reveal the mechanism of low temperature cracking of asphalt pavement in alpine region.(4)Study on prevention and cure measures of low temperature cracking of asphalt pavement in alpine region.Based on the low temperature bending test of trabecula,the effects of AC-13,SMA-13 gradation,base asphalt,SBS modified asphalt,rubber asphalt and polyester fiber on low temperature cracking resistance of asphalt mixture were studied.The prevention measures of low temperature cracking of asphalt pavement in alpine region were given from the aspects of material selection,structural design and construction control.
